Abstract
The utility model discloses a kind of cage structures of off-lying sea cultivation, include the montant of four rectangular arrangements, in the upper of the montant, bend pipe is welded and connected at lower end, there is connecting tube by the elbow fittings between two adjacent montants, it is connected with flange between the connecting tube and the bend pipe, a net cage is provided between the inside of four montants, the top of the net cage has the opening for launching feed, suture is fixed with multiple ring portions at the outer ring position of the opening, a constraint rope is equipped between multiple ring portions, the opening is closed after the both ends of constraint rope tense, suture is fixed with positioning sleeve at the outer fix of the net cage, the connecting tube passes through the positioning sleeve, the bottom position of the lower section connecting tube is provided with a hollow babinet;The present apparatus can be realized in off-lying sea and be cultivated, and temporarily, dive can be realized by way of water filling, effectively hides typhoon disaster, without towing back to bank in typhoon weather.

Technical field
The utility model is related to a kind of cage structures of off-lying sea cultivation.
Background technology
With the variation of global climate, the quantity of typhoon increases, and destructive power is increasing, is caused to sea farming prodigious
Loss.
Be directed to the threat of typhoon both at home and abroad, take mostly approach in advance, the passive measure such as structural strengthening.But thus cause
Cost it is higher, drag also can cause to damage back and forth to net cage, equipment and fish.
Based on the above issues, it is desirable to provide one kind can be realized in off-lying sea and be cultivated, and temporarily, to pass through in typhoon weather
The mode of water filling realizes dive, effectively hides typhoon disaster, the cage structure of the off-lying sea cultivation without towing back to bank.

It is preferable in weather, the water in babinet can be extracted out by hose to water pump, after water extraction,
Box house is hollow so that net cage integrally floats, and according to the height of required floating, control pump-out is stopped when meeting floating height
Only draw water;When net cage floats, it is located at aquatic products in net cage convenient for capture and is sealed by cinch cord when weather is more severe
Make and break mouth so that the aquatic products inside net cage can not flee, and be supplied water at this time using water pump in babinet so that the sky in babinet
Gas is reduced, and net cage starts to sink, and after sinking down into target depth, is stopped supplying water, is realized and close to hose, you can realize stopping for net cage
It stays, effectively hides typhoon disaster.
The utility model has the beneficial effects that:When in use, by changing the water in babinet, this may be implemented in the present apparatus
The upper and lower floating of device, convenient for hiding the hazard weathers such as typhoon, operation is more convenient, without towing back to bank, reduce cultivation at
This, the structure of the present apparatus is relatively simple, and cost is more cheap, is suitble to promote the use of.
